  • What is the purpose of comminution?

    In mineral processing or metallurgy, the first stage of comminution is crushing. In principle, compression crushing is used on hard and abrasive rocks by placing them between a high wear-resistant plate/surface. Less abrasive and softer rocks or stones are crushed by impact and shear but also compressive mechanisms.

    Comminution Communiation is one of the primary operations in mineral dressing ;takes place in a sequence of crushing and grinding processes. COMMINUTION

    COMMINUTION AND LIBERATION When considering comminution for mineral processing operations, the question of mineral liberation must always be considered. The random fragmentation of multicomponent mineral ores to a size scale that is comparable to the size of the mineral grains gives rise to the phenomenon of liberation.

  • Comminution

    Comminution. The process of comminution is the crushing and grinding of a material / ore to reduce it to smaller or finer particles. The comminution process reduces particle sizes by breaking, crushing, or grinding of ore, rock, coal, or other materials.
